Basic Polynomial Algebra Subprograms (BPAS)  v. 1.652
BigPrimeField Member List

This is the complete list of members for BigPrimeField, including all inherited members.

BigPrimeField() (defined in BigPrimeField)BigPrimeField
BigPrimeField(mpz_class _a) (defined in BigPrimeField)BigPrimeField
BigPrimeField(long int _a) (defined in BigPrimeField)BigPrimeField
BigPrimeField(const BigPrimeField &c) (defined in BigPrimeField)BigPrimeField
BigPrimeField(const Integer &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const RationalNumber &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const ComplexRationalNumber &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const SmallPrimeField &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const GeneralizedFermatPrimeField &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const DenseUnivariateIntegerPolynomial &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const DenseUnivariateRationalPolynomial &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const SparseUnivariatePolynomial< Integer > &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const SparseUnivariatePolynomial< RationalNumber > &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const SparseUnivariatePolynomial< ComplexRationalNumber > &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BigPrimeField(const SparseUnivariatePolynomial< Ring > &c) (defined in BigPrimeField)BigPrimeFieldexplicit
BPFpointer(BigPrimeField *b) (defined in BigPrimeField)BigPrimeField
BPFpointer(RationalNumber *a) (defined in BigPrimeField)BigPrimeField
BPFpointer(SmallPrimeField *a) (defined in BigPrimeField)BigPrimeField
BPFpointer(GeneralizedFermatPrimeField *a) (defined in BigPrimeField)BigPrimeField
characteristic (defined in BigPrimeField)BigPrimeFieldstatic
convertToExpressionTree() constBigPrimeFieldinlinevirtual
euclideanDivision(const BigPrimeField &b, BigPrimeField *q=NULL) constBigPrimeFieldvirtual
euclideanSize() constBigPrimeFieldinlinevirtual
extendedEuclidean(const BigPrimeField &b, BigPrimeField *s=NULL, BigPrimeField *t=NULL) constBigPrimeFieldvirtual
findPrimitiveRootOfUnity(long int n) const (defined in BigPrimeField)BigPrimeFieldinlinevirtual
findPrimitiveRootofUnity(mpz_class n) (defined in BigPrimeField)BigPrimeFieldinlinestatic
gcd(const BigPrimeField &other) constBigPrimeFieldinlinevirtual
gcd(long int c) (defined in BigPrimeField)BigPrimeFieldinline
gcd(const mpz_class &c) const (defined in BigPrimeField)BigPrimeFieldinline
inverse() constBigPrimeFieldinlinevirtual
isConstant() const (defined in BigPrimeField)BigPrimeFieldinline
isNegativeOne() const (defined in BigPrimeField)BigPrimeFieldinline
isOne() constBigPrimeFieldinlinevirtual
isZero() constBigPrimeFieldinlinevirtual
negativeOne() (defined in BigPrimeField)BigPrimeFieldinline
number() const (defined in BigPrimeField)BigPrimeField
one()BigPrimeFieldinlinevirtual
operator!=(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ator!=(const mpz_class &k) const (defined in BigPrimeField)BigPrimeFieldinline
operator!=(long int k) const (defined in BigPrimeField)BigPrimeFieldinline
operator%(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ator%=(const BigPrimeField &c)BigPrimeFieldinlinevirtual
operator*(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ator*(const mpz_class &c) const (defined in BigPrimeField)BigPrimeFieldinline
operator*(long int c) const (defined in BigPrimeField)BigPrimeFieldinline
operator*=(const BigPrimeField &c)BigPrimeFieldinlinevirtual
operator*=(const mpz_class &m) (defined in BigPrimeField)BigPrimeFieldinline
operator*=(long int c) (defined in BigPrimeField)BigPrimeFieldinline
operator+(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ator+(long int c) const (defined in BigPrimeField)BigPrimeFieldinline
operator+(const mpz_class &c) const (defined in BigPrimeField)BigPrimeFieldinline
operator+=(const BigPrimeField &c)BigPrimeFieldinlinevirtual
operator+=(long int c) (defined in BigPrimeField)BigPrimeFieldinline
operator+=(const mpz_class &c) (defined in BigPrimeField)BigPrimeFieldinline
operator-(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ator-(long int c) const (defined in BigPrimeField)BigPrimeFieldinline
operator-(const mpz_class &c) const (defined in BigPrimeField)BigPrimeFieldinline
operator-() constBigPrimeFieldinlinevirtual
operator-=(const BigPrimeField &c)BigPrimeFieldinlinevirtual
operator-=(long int c) (defined in BigPrimeField)BigPrimeFieldinline
operator-=(const mpz_class &c) (defined in BigPrimeField)BigPrimeFieldinline
operator/(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ator/(long int c) const (defined in BigPrimeField)BigPrimeFieldinline
operator/(const mpz_class &c) const (defined in BigPrimeField)BigPrimeFieldinline
operator/=(const BigPrimeField &c)BigPrimeFieldinlinevirtual
operator/=(long int c) (defined in BigPrimeField)BigPrimeFieldinline
operator/=(const mpz_class &c) (defined in BigPrimeField)BigPrimeFieldinline
operator=(const BigPrimeField &c)BigPrimeFieldvirtual
operator=(long int k) (defined in BigPrimeField)BigPrimeField
operator=(const mpz_class &k) (defined in BigPrimeField)BigPrimeField
operator==(const BigPrimeField &c) constBigPrimeFieldinlinevirtual
operator==(const mpz_class &k) const (defined in BigPrimeField)BigPrimeFieldinline
operator==(long int k) const (defined in BigPrimeField)BigPrimeFieldinline
operator^(long long int c) constBigPrimeFieldinlinevirtual
operator^(const mpz_class &exp) const (defined in BigPrimeField)BigPrimeFieldinline
operator^=(long long int c)BigPrimeFieldinlinevirtual
operator^=(const mpz_class &e) (defined in BigPrimeField)BigPrimeFieldinline
Prime() const (defined in BigPrimeField)BigPrimeField
properties (defined in BigPrimeField)BigPrimeFieldstatic
quotient(const BigPrimeField &b) constBigPrimeFieldvirtual
remainder(const BigPrimeField &b) constBigPrimeFieldvirtual
setPrime(mpz_class p) (defined in BigPrimeField)BigPrimeFieldinlinestatic
squareFree() constBigPrimeFieldinlinevirtual
unitCanonical(BigPrimeField *u=NULL, BigPrimeField *v=NULL) constBigPrimeFieldvirtual
whichprimefield() (defined in BigPrimeField)BigPrimeField
zero()BigPrimeFieldinlinevirtual